Lois Delois Plant

Photo of Lois Delois Plant
Lois Plant, 94, of Conway, was born Lenora Delois Tedder in Ellisville, Calhoun Co, AR, February 24, 1916. She went home to be with Jesus on October 12, 2010, in Little Rock. Her church home was Conway First Church of the Nazarene. Prior to that she attended Amboy Baptist Church in Oak Grove. She was owner of Hillcrest Beauty Shoppe in Little Rock for many years. Her life was dedicated to teaching Sunday school from the age of 12 to 88. She was a mighty prayer warrior from an early age until her death. She began and ended each day in prayer and saw many answers and miracles in the lives of those she loved and prayed for. She was preceded in death by her husbands Marvin Worth Ruple of Little Rock and Jake Plant of North Little Rock, her brothers Griffith and Jim Tedder, and her parents, Lera Jane (Shook) and James Monroe Tedder. She is survived by her brother Dr. Lawrence Tedder and wife Gladys of Colorado and sister Marjorie Watson of Little Rock, her sons, Jack Ruple Sr. and Jimmy Ruple and his wife Lavonda all of Faulkner County, and grandchildren, David Ruple, Suzanne (Ruple) Martin, Steven Ruple, Jack Ruple Jr. and John Ruple, nieces and nephews, seven great-grandchildren, two step-granddaughters, Tiffany and Mackenzie, and many church friends and family.
